Using Quantitative Methods to Understand Gender and Intersectionality in Urban Health Research: The MAIHDA approach

This guide introduces MAIHDA (Multilevel Analysis of Individual Heterogeneity and Discriminatory Accuracy), a quantitative approach for understanding how gender and other overlapping social factors, such as age, ethnicity, and socioeconomic status, combine to shape health inequalities. It explains how MAIHDA helps researchers identify vulnerable population groups, measure intersectional inequities, and generate evidence to support more targeted and equitable health policies and interventions.
